FACING HUNGER FOODBANK INC, founded in 1983, is a mid-sized nonprofit that reported $22.3M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 20%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um.

Mission

THE FACING HUNGER FOODBANK, INC. PROVIDES FOOD AND COMMODITIES TO MEMBER AGENCIES WHO DISTRIBUTE THE ITEMS TO THE HUNGRY IN 17 COUNTIES IN WEST VIRGINIA, KENTUCKY AND OHIO.
